Paragard IUD's have no hormonal component, but uterine contractions may displace the IUD into the cervical canal, and cause minor bleeding and cramps. IUD's like Paragard do not protect against pregnancy outside the uterus (ectopic), so obtain a serum HCG to be certain. See your GYN physician and ask about a sonogram to determine the location of the IUD.
